Pros

Like all public-owned giant flagships, Cree offers good employee benefits, like decent health insurance, stock rewards, employee stock purchase plans, etc. I used to be proud of working for Cree, for that I could be a small part of a big difference.

Cons

Also like other big ships, Cree had such a large crew that it was not easy to organize. Lacking of clear directions or communications across departments and teams sometimes made the work inefficient. Each division could only see a small part of the whole picture and focused on its own targets. Sometimes it was good, for that there was less distraction. Sometimes not, things could get political and dramatic. Cree was trying really hard to reshape and reaim herself in reaction to the changes in lighting business. However for such a giant ship, it takes time (you can see that from the stock price). She had a brilliant and cheerful crew, but after a long, tough journey, the crew became less cheerful. Rumors began to spread, an intense atmosphere was building up and would not be easy to shake off. If you want to apply for a job in Cree, you should ask yourself if you will feel happy working in such a work environment, for a relatively long period of time.
